Weather in March

March, the first month of the spring in Arboles, is a frosty month, with temperature in the range of an average high of 43°F (6.1°C) and an average low of 22.6°F (-5.2°C).

Temperature

March's arrival signals a temperature shift, moving from a cold 33.4°F (0.8°C) in February to a chilly 43°F (6.1°C). Arboles experiences a consistent average temperature of 22.6°F (-5.2°C) throughout the nights in March.

Humidity

In March, the average relative humidity in Arboles, Colorado, is 69%.

Rainfall

In March, the rain falls for 7 days. Throughout March, 1.65" (42mm) of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 107.8 rainfall days, and 18.07" (459m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all in Arboles are January through May, October through December. In Arboles, in March, during 9.3 snowfall days, 10.47" (266mm) of snow is typically accumulated. In Arboles, during the entire year, snow falls for 61.6 days and aggregates up to 62.48" (1587mm) of sn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in March in Arboles is 11h and 59min.
On the first day of March, sunrise is at 6:39 am and sunset at 6:04 pm MST.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:55 am and sunset at 7:31 pm MDT.
Note: On Sunday, March 10. 2024, at 2:00 am, Daylight Saving Time starts, and the time zone changes from MST to MDT. Daylight Saving Time lasts until Sunday, November 3. 2024, at 2:00 am; consequently, the time zone reverts from MDT to MST.

Sunshine

In March, the average sunshine in Arboles is 8.8h.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index in Arboles are January through March, October through December, with an average maximum UV index of 2. A UV Index of 2, and less, symbolizes a minimal health hazard from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the average person.
Note: A maximum high daily UV index of 2 during March translates into the following directions:
Though the majority can handle prolonged sun exposure, it is crucial to always shield babies, children, and those with fair skin. The solar radiation is most powerful near the mid-day, so the exposure to the direct Sun should be reduced accordingly. A wide-brim hat offers excellent sun protection for the eyes, ears, face, and neck. Sunglasses with UVA and UVB protection significantly reduce eye damage from sun exposure. Be aware! The intensity of the Sun's UV radiation can be amplified nearly twice due to snow reflection.
